What the Data Says About Statia

The Social Security Administration has registered 167 babies named Statia between 1908 and 1991, spanning 84 consecutive years of U.S. birth records. As a girl's name, Statia currently falls outside the top 1,000 girls' names for 1991. The name reached its historical peak in 1916, when 22 babies received it in a single year.

Decade-level aggregation shows that Statia performed strongest in the 1910s, accumulating 99 births during that ten-year window. Across the 4 decades of recorded activity, Statia shows a clear decline from its mid-century high. These figures derive from SSA's annual national and state-level name files, which include any name appearing at least five times in a given year or state-year; names below that threshold are suppressed for privacy and therefore excluded from the totals shown here. The 167 total represents a lower bound — actual usage may be higher in years or states where the count fell below the disclosure floor.
